Course overview

This is a complete 20-week AI engineering roadmap designed for learners who want to build real AI applications, not just watch theory. You will begin with Python programming foundations, move into data science and mathematics, then build machine learning and deep learning models, explore transformers and LLMs, design RAG pipelines, and finally deploy production-grade agentic AI systems with FastAPI, LangChain, LangGraph, Docker, CI/CD and observability. By the end, you will have a complete portfolio of AI projects proving that you can build, train, integrate and deploy AI systems end to end.

Curriculum

20 modules · 454 lectures

1.1 Introduction to Programming & Python

  • 1What programming is and why Python is the best starting point for AI
  • 2Python installation, setup and virtual environments
  • 3Python interpreter, REPL and script execution

1.2 Core Data Types & Operators

  • 1Variables, assignment and naming conventions
  • 2Numeric types, arithmetic and comparison operators
  • 3Strings, indexing, slicing and formatting

1.3 Collections & Data Structures

  • 1Lists, mutation and common methods
  • 2Tuples and immutability use cases
  • 3Dictionaries for key-value storage and lookup
  • 4Sets for uniqueness, intersection and union operations
Hands-on lab
Calculator and String Processor

Build small Python programs that perform calculations, process strings and use lists, dictionaries and sets to organize data.
